Columbus Blue Jackets Secure Egor Zamula
According to Elliotte Friedman, the Columbus Blue Jackets have made a move to secure defenseman Egor Zamula after he successfully went unclaimed on waivers. Previously signed with the Philadelphia Flyers, Zamula has accumulated a total of 168 NHL appearances, contributing 41 points over his career.
General Manager’s Enthusiasm
Don Waddell, the team’s general manager, expressed enthusiasm about the signing, highlighting Zamula’s skill set. He stated that Zamula is a well-sized, agile defenseman who has a sharp understanding of the game and excels at moving the puck.
Contract Details
The one-year contract is set to be a prorated deal worth $1 million, as confirmed by Zamula’s agent, Dan Milstein. On January 6, 2026, Milstein issued a statement outlining Zamula’s proactive approach to his career. He revealed that on December 20, 2025, Zamula reached out to their agency, Gold Star Hockey, with the goal of rapidly securing another chance in the NHL.
